Africa-Press – Botswana. Last Sunday, the Ugandan Government reported on social media that nine positive cases were detected in the country’s capital, Kampala, reaching 14 in the last 48 hours.
” 23 October 2022, nine individuals were confirmed positive for Ebola” in Kampala and its metropolitan area, “bringing the total number of cases to 14 in the last 48 hours”, said the Ugandan top health official.
According to Lusa, which advances the news, citing the aforementioned professional, Jane Ruth Aceng Ocero, who published on Twitter, infected people in Kampala were in contact with a patient from Kasanda, another district, who visited the country’s capital, at the beginning of the month. Altogether, the Health Minister said that 42 individuals had been identified who had contact with the man, and are now being closely followed.
Lusa also underlines that 28 deaths have already been recorded and 90 cases are confirmed due to the Ebola outbreak throughout Uganda.
